Q: Is 118,821,392 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 118,821,392 is a composite number.

Why is 118,821,392 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 118,821,392 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 251 502 1,004 2,008 4,016 29,587 59,174 118,348 236,696 473,392 7,426,337 14,852,674 29,705,348 59,410,696 and 118,821,392, with no remainder.

Since 118,821,392 cannot be divided by just 1 and 118,821,392, it is a composite number.
